How much do translation project freelance jobs pay per hour?

As of May 31, 2026, the average hourly pay for translation project freelance in the United States is $46.24,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$40.14 and $50.72 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Translation Project Freelance vs Translation Agency Project Coordinator?

AspectTranslation Project FreelanceTranslation Agency Project Coordinator
CredentialsLanguage proficiency, translation experienceLanguage skills, project management knowledge
Work EnvironmentRemote, independentOffice or remote, team-based
EmployerSelf-employed or individual clientsTranslation agencies or firms
Industry UsageFreelance translation projectsManaging multiple translation projects

While both roles involve managing translation tasks, a Translation Project Freelance works independently on client projects, focusing on translation quality and deadlines. In contrast, a Translation Agency Project Coordinator oversees multiple projects within an agency, coordinating between clients, translators, and quality assurance teams. The freelance role offers flexibility, whereas the coordinator role involves more structured team management.

Position Overview:
As a Translation Operations Department Intern at TE, you will gain valuable hands-on experience in the dynamic field of translation project management and language services coordination. You will work closely with our experienced team, assisting in the planning, execution, and monitoring of translation projects. This internship offers an excellent opportunity to learn about the translation industry and contribute to our mission of connecting people through language.
Key Responsibilities:
  • Assist Project Managers: Collaborate with project managers to support the successful execution of translation projects, including document preparation, vendor coordination, and quality assurance checks.
  • Vendor Management: Assist in identifying and onboarding freelance translators and language experts. Maintain clear and organized vendor records.
  • Quality Control: Conduct quality checks on translated content to ensure accuracy and adherence to client-specific requirements.
  • Project Documentation: Assist in the creation and maintenance of project documentation, including project plans, timelines, and progress reports.
  • Communication: Facilitate communication between project stakeholders, including clients, translators, and internal team members.
  • Research: Conduct research related to specific translation projects, industries, or language nuances to support project success.
  • Administrative Tasks: Assist with administrative tasks, such as invoicing, project tracking, and file management.
  • Process Improvement: Identify areas for process improvement and contribute to the development of best practices within the Translation Operations Department.
